Handover note — Crumbwheel order cutoffs.

Welcome aboard. The bakery cutoff rule in Crumbwheel closes same-day orders at 14:00 local to each storefront, not UTC — this has bitten us twice. Holiday overrides live in the calendar service and take precedence silently, so always check there first when a cutoff looks wrong. To unlock the calendar service's admin console after a restart, enter the recovery passphrase below.

vault phrase of bagap-bahaf = silion-pelox-sorox-casdor-quenwyn-fraax-eliox-praael-kelion-quenvan-kasox-rusael-norius-belvan

Hi Renke, welcome to the Quillhaven on-call rotation. Quick but important note ahead of the weekly eng sync: all services in the Lattice monorepo must use exact-version pins, no ranges, no wildcards. Our lockfile checker, Pinwheel, blocks merges that violate this, but hotfix branches sometimes bypass it, so watch for surprise upgrades in deploy diffs. If a pinned package has a security advisory, bump it via the standard exception flow. The full policy, including the exception template, lives on this page.

wiki page, tahaf-tajog: https://jira.ordindyn.corp/pipeline

The renewal of our three-year agreement with Torvane Materials has been assessed in detail. Proposed terms include a 4.2% unit-price increase, partially offset by improved volume rebates and extended payment terms of sixty days. Sensitivity analysis indicates a net annual cost impact of under 1% on the Meridia product line, assuming stable demand. Legal has flagged no material changes to liability clauses. We recommend approval, subject to the conditions outlined in the confidential note below.

confidential, yawip-bahif: Zorokox Partners plans to lower the Casax list price by 28.0 percent in April. The board signed off on a budget of $271.0 million for Project Juldor. The renewal with Pelokox Partners closes at $410.1 million a year, 3.4 percent below the last contract. Project Pelok slips by a full year because of the audit delay.